State (Hawaii)
Hawaii 2024 Regular Session

Relating To The Residential Landlord-tenant Code. [SB-2132]
Amends the deadline related to the repair of conditions that constitute health or safety violations. Increases the amount deducted from a tenant's rent for the tenant's actual expenditures to correct health or safety violations and defective conditions. Takes effect 11/1/2024. (CD1)

  

Sponsored by: Sen. Joy San Buenaventura Act 032, 05/28/2024 (gov. Msg. No. 1132). on 05/29/2024

State (Hawaii)
Hawaii 2024 Regular Session

Relating To The Landlord-tenant Code. [SB-1133]
Extends from 5 business days to 15 calendar days the period for a notice of termination of a rental agreement. Requires landlords to engage in mediation and delay the filing of an action for summary possession if a tenant schedules or attempts to schedule a mediation. Requires landlords to provide specific information in the 15-calendar day notice to tenants and certain mediation centers. Appropriates moneys.

  

Sponsored by: Sen. Angus McKelvey Carried Over To 2024 Regular Session. on 12/11/2023

State (Hawaii)
Hawaii 2023 Regular Session

Relating To The Landlord-tenant Code. [SB-393]
Establishes and appropriates funds for a pre-litigation mediation pilot program. Requires landlords to participate in mediation before filing an action for summary possession. Creates and appropriates funds for an emergency rent relief program to be made available to participants in the pre-litigation mediation pilot program. Sunsets 6/30/2025. Effective 6/30/3000. (HD3)

  

Sponsored by: Sen. Donovan Cruz Received Notice Of Senate Conferees (sen. Com. No. 904). on 04/18/2023
